This Date in Astros History
Aug 26 1962 - Snapping a nine-game losing skid, the Colts sweep a twinbill from the Reds, 2-1 and 6-4. Lefty George Brunet scatters five hits in the opener, outdueling Jim Maloney. In the nightcap, Johnny Temple, a former All-Star in Cincy, singles home the winning runs in the ninth inning before Jim Umbricht strikes out the side to finish the sweep. Jim Campbell adds a two-run homer for Houston.

Sep 05 1962 - Jim Umbricht gets his first major league hit and his first win as a Colt .45. His RBI single scores Johnny Temple to cap a 5-3 victory over Pittsburgh. Jim Pendleton drives home the winning run with a hit off 43-year-old rookie Diomedes Olivo.

Jul 01 1963 - Ernie Fazio scores on a single from Rusty Staub in the 11th inning for a 4-3 victory over St. Louis. It is Staub's second RBI of the game. Hal Woodeshick wins his eighth, all in relief. Johnny Temple drives in the Colts' other two runs with a single in the eighth inning.

Jan 09 1994 - Johnny Temple dies at age 66 in White Rock, SC. A five-time all-star in Cincinnati, he has a .263 average over two seasons with the Colt .45s as a reserve then comes back to Houston as a sportscaster for KHOU-TV.
